Taco Bell, East 11th Street, Tulsa, OK, USA
3 years ago •reported by user-xthf1995 • details
3 years ago •reported by user-xthf1995 • details
3 years ago •reported by user-wxrr4854 • details
3 years ago •reported by user-yypc1133 • details
3 years ago •reported by user-xxxhj748 • details
3 years ago •reported by user-tjqdy317 • details
3 years ago •reported by user-tmxmh623 • details
3 years ago •reported by user-ncpn1357 • details
3 years ago •reported by user-qfbyj862 • details
3 years ago •reported by user-xxdbq568 • details
3 years ago •reported by user-yhmz8311 • details
Advanced Filter